Tachi: Kasha
From FFXIclopedia, the free Final Fantasy XI encyclopedia
- Skill level: 250
- In order to obtain Tachi: Kasha, the quest The Potential Within must be completed.
- Paralyzes target. Damage varies with TP.
- Will stack with Sneak Attack.
Properties
- Element: None
- Skillchain Properties:
Fusion/
Compression
- Damage Multipliers by TP:
100%TP 200%TP 300%TP 1.5625 1.875 2.50
Translation
See Tachi: Enpi for the translation of "Tachi:"
This weaponskill's original name in the Japanese version is:
九之太刀・花車 (Kyuu no Tachi: Kassha)
"Ninth Style of the Tachi: 'Wheel of Flowers'."
Kasha can also be pronounced 'Hanaguruma', which is a kind of Chinese flower. It is a Clematis, which is a kind of 'climbing' flower (it grows in vines up available collumns, trees, etc). A Hanaguruma flower is seen during the animation of this weaponskill.
Levels
- While Samurai may obtain a Great Katana skill level of 250 earlier than level 71, Tachi: Kasha can only be quested once base skill level 250 (without merits) and a job level 71 is reached (in order to wield the Tachi of Trials).
- Great Katana skill level 250 is obtainable by the following jobs at these corresponding levels:
Job Rating Level Samurai A+ 70
